Heavy stores for winter finishing a ‘very strong’ trade at Carnew

Carnew Mart – cattle prices – 30-10-2021

According to Eugene Clune, heifers met with a “very solid” trade at Carnew Mart on Saturday, October 30th, 2021.

He reported that “many farmers were around the ring for lighter stores, which led to top prices”.

Carnew Mart 30-10-2021

Clune outlined that most heifers – half-Friesian-type stock – in the 350-450kg weight bracket sold for €2.00-€2.20/kg. Meanwhile, suckler-type heifers of this strength ranged from €2.40/€2.50.”

“Heavier stores ready for winter finishing met a very strong trade with €2.50/kg plus freely available for the right stock over 500kg.”

“Heavier heifers sold to a top price of €1,660 for a 720kg CH, with most of the heavier heifers selling between €2.20- €2.40/kg.”

Bullock prices:

Bullocks met a “very lively trade” with factory agents and northern customers alike “very active” for strong bullocks.

Clune reported that €2.50/kg was “freely available” at the mart’s general cattle sale.

“We recorded a top price on the day of €2,000 for 800kg Belgian-Blue-cross bullocks. 6 Limousin bullocks sold together weighing 660kg and made €1,690 or €2.56/kg. Quality store bullocks sold very well throughout.”

  • 430KG – LM – €1120;
  • 444KG – CH – €1210;
  • 530KG – LM – €1290;
  • 500KG – CH – €1220.

Plainer store bullocks went under the hammer for €2/kg for the more Friesian-types to €2.25/kg for the lighter, plainer continental-types.

Cull cow prices

Meanwhile, just under 200 cull cows met with a “firm trade” at the Wicklow-based mart on Friday evening.

Clune reported that all “store Friesian cows direct from the parlour with no flesh sold from €1/kg to €200 over the weight”.

“Meanwhile, the heavier fleshed Friesian cows sold to €400 with the kg.” On the other hand, heavy continental cows met a “very steady trade”.

Most sold for between the €1.80-€2.00/kg, while heavier beef types broke the €2.00/kg barrier, with entries reaching highs of €2,010.
